What were you trying to do?
	examine an AFS mount point with fs.

What's wrong:
	fs seems to have trouble noticing mount points after traversing
symbolic links:

[{1}lycus:/afs/athena.mit.edu/astaff/project/krb5]
% fs lsm /afs/athena.mit.edu/astaff/project/krb5/OldFiles
'/afs/athena.mit.edu/astaff/project/krb5/OldFiles' is a mount point for volume '
#aproj.krb5.backup'
[{1}lycus:/afs/athena.mit.edu/astaff/project/krb5]
% fs lsm /mit/krb5/OldFiles
'/mit/krb5/OldFiles' is not a mount point.
[{1}lycus:/afs/athena.mit.edu/astaff/project/krb5]
% ls -l /mit/krb5
lrwxrwxrwx  1 root           39 Mar 29 08:34 /mit/krb5 -> /afs/athena.mit.edu/as
taff/project/krb5
[{1}lycus:/afs/athena.mit.edu/astaff/project/krb5]
% where fs
/bin/fs
[{1}lycus:/afs/athena.mit.edu/astaff/project/krb5]
% pwd

What should have happened:
	fs should have recognized it as a mount point.
